Cannot figure this out. The lower page border disappears when in print
preview mode. Also the bottom border will not print. Tried to adjust the margins. Even tried changing the set up in borders. I'm at a loss. |

This is a limitation of your printer, not of Word. Most printers
have some amount of nonprintable area along each edge of the page. Word displays the printable area of the page in Print Preview. The usual solution is to increase the border "from edge" setting (as described in http://www.word.mvps.org/FAQs/Format...sDontPrint.htm ) until the border prints. Try changing the "Measure from:" option to "Text" rather than "Edge of Page"
and change the tiny 1 pt and 4 pt margins to something like 18 pt. This places the border 18 pts away from the text 'boundary' ie the margin. This works for me every time.
